How much do intern fixed income j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 4, 2026, the average hourly pay for intern fixed income in New York is $20.61,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.77 and $21.30 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an intern fixed income do?

An Intern Fixed Income typically supports the fixed income team at a financial institution by conducting research, analyzing market data, and assisting with the management of bond portfolios. They help evaluate bonds and other debt securities, monitor interest rate trends, and prepare reports for senior analysts or portfolio managers. The internship provides hands-on experience in understanding fixed income markets, risk analysis, and investment strategies. Interns often use financial modeling tools and gain exposure to trading and investment decision-making processes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an intern fixed income?

To thrive as an Intern in Fixed Income, you generally need strong quantitative and analytical skills, a background in finance or economics, and proficiency in Excel and financial modeling. Familiarity with Bloomberg Terminal, trading platforms, and relevant financial certifications like CFA Level I can be advantageous. Excellent attention to detail, teamwork, and effective communication help you interpret data and collaborate with senior professionals. These skills and qualities are essential for accurate market analysis, supporting investment decisions, and succeeding in a fast-paced financial environment.

What kinds of projects or tasks can an intern fixed income expect to work on during their internship?

As an Intern in Fixed Income, you can expect to work on a variety of tasks such as assisting with market research, analyzing bond portfolios, and supporting the team with data collection and report generation. You may also help monitor market news, create presentations for client meetings, and learn how to use financial modeling tools under the supervision of experienced analysts. This exposure allows you to develop a foundational understanding of fixed income products and the decision-making process within a collaborative team environment.

What is the difference between Intern Fixed Income vs Intern Equity Research?

AspectIntern Fixed IncomeIntern Equity Research
Required CredentialsTypically pursuing finance, economics, or related degrees; some certifications like CFA Level I beneficialSimilar educational background; CFA Level I advantageous
Work EnvironmentFinancial institutions, asset management firms, investment banksAsset management firms, investment banks, research boutiques
Industry UsageCommonly used in bond markets, fixed income securities analysisFocused on stock markets, equity valuation, and company analysis

Intern Fixed Income and Intern Equity Research roles share similar educational requirements and work environments, often found within investment firms and banks. The main difference lies in the asset class focus: fixed income involves bonds and debt securities, while equity research centers on stocks and company valuation. Both roles serve as entry points into investment analysis, but they specialize in different financial instruments.

PIMCO is a global leader in active fixed income. With our launch in 1971 in Newport Beach, California, PIMCO introduced investors to a total return approach to fixed income investing. In the 50+ years since, we have worked relentlessly to help millions of investors pursue their objectives - regardless of shifting marketing conditions. Global Wealth Management (GWM)'s mission is to create industry leading experiences for financial intermediaries and their individual investor clients while providing a strong contribution to PIMCO's overall business results. PIMCO GWM is responsible for business strategy and client coverage for financial intermediaries and their advisors. Coverage includes RIAs, Wirehouses, family offices, banks/trusts, independent broker dealers, platforms, and sub-advisory relationships.

Growth Markets:
  • The Growth Markets group focuses on accelerating growth across product lines with unique technology, service, and operational needs beyond our core mutual fund franchise. The group is responsible for leading business strategy, innovation, and growth initiatives across SMAs, ETFs, Models, Insurance Solutions, and Blockchain/Tokenization. The summer analyst intern will contribute to the team through supporting the group's key strategic initiatives.
